Summary

The Regional RN Care Coordinator ensures that resident care needs are met by coordinating and ensuring assessments are completed and all residents have accurate service plans at assigned locations as requested by regional or community leadership. Provide training and education of staff in all areas of health-related services, policies and procedures as assigned. The Regional RN Care Coordinator supports multiple communities, providing RN services to include on-call support and phone triage, nursing assessments, evaluating and documenting significant changes in condition, performing wound assessments, and conducting on-site routine clinical reviews.

Essential duties and

Responsibilities

  • Completes or oversees nursing assessments required for significant changes of condition, in accordance with applicable regulations. Assesses health, functional and psychosocial status of residents. Participates in the development of individualized service plans.
  • Supports multiple communities as assigned, providing RN oversight and ensuring timely completion of required nursing evaluations and documentation. Responsibilities include phone triage, on-call support, wound assessments, significant change evaluations, and routine clinical reviews.
  • Provides training of staff in health-related services including but not limited to providing personal care and medication management.
  • Oversees the documentation and communication of resident care and services. Assists the management team to ensure resident records are completed in a timely manner and maintained according to company policies and state regulations.
  • Delegating nursing tasks may be required, as permitted under applicable state nursing laws and practice acts, with appropriate communication maintained with residents, their families, and health care practitioners.
  • Maintains and oversees medication services including staff training, staff oversight, pharmacy coordination, medication room and medication systems.
  • Maintains up-to-date knowledge of all rules, regulations and policies pertaining to resident care. Stays informed of industry and health care trends and standards, applying new knowledge to meet the changing needs of residents. Seeks out additional expertise and advice when needed to assure residents’ needs are met and proper practices followed.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Qualifications and

Experience

Must have current, unencumbered RN license in the state of practice. Experience in wound assessments, coordination of care, weight monitoring and interventions as needed, identifying and troubleshooting shooting for a change of condition required. Experience in geriatric nursing, medication administration, case management, and training and staff development preferred.

Delegation experience in the state assigned preferred.

Education

Registered Nurse license and Bachelor of Science in Nursing or Associate Degree in Nursing.:
